BD announced that its CentroVena One Insertion System earned Vizient's Innovative Technology contract, validating its all-in-one design across Vizient's provider network (> $156B annual purchasing volume). The system reportedly reduces steps by 30% and maximum procedure time by 50% versus traditional methods, potentially expanding BD's hospital-market penetration and near-term revenue opportunities.
